What Is a Music Store POS System?

A music store POS system is a combination of software and hardware that supports the management of sales, rentals, inventory, and customer transactions. Beyond simple checkout functionality, it integrates multiple business operations such as inventory control, customer management, and reporting, all in real time.

Whether your music shop sells guitars, rents instruments, or provides repair services, a music store POS system guarantees accuracy, efficiency, and seamless coordination across departments. The result? Faster checkouts, better inventory tracking, and a more professional customer experience.

Key Features of a Music Store POS System

An efficient music store POS system should come equipped with robust features that cater to the unique needs of a musical retail business.

  • Comprehensive Inventory Management: Automate tracking of thousands of SKUs, manage suppliers, and receive low-stock alerts to affirm your shelves are always stocked with popular items.
  • Sales and Checkout Management: Enable quick checkouts with barcode scanning, multiple payment options, and real-time synchronization across online and in-store transactions.
  • Customer Relationship Management (CRM): Store customer data, track loyalty points, and deliver personalized offers to build stronger, lasting relationships.
  • Rental and Repair Management: Easily manage instrument rentals, deposits, due dates, and repair updates with automated reminders and technician notes.
  • Multi-Channel Integration: Sync your in-store and online sales to provide a seamless shopping experience with features like “buy online, pick up in-store.”
  • Reporting and Analytics: Access real-time performance data to identify top products, manage staff performance, and make informed business decisions.
  • Hardware Compatibility: Work smoothly with barcode scanners, receipt printers, and other POS devices to streamline daily operations.

How to Choose the Right Music Store POS System?

Choosing the ideal music store POS system requires evaluating functionality, flexibility, and long-term value.

Cloud vs. On-Premise System

  • Cloud-based systems (like ConnectPOS) offer accessibility from anywhere, lower upfront costs, and automatic updates.
  • On-premise systems provide local data control but require higher maintenance and hardware investment.

For most modern music retailers, cloud-based solutions offer superior scalability and convenience.

Integration Capabilities

Make sure your POS integrates smoothly with your eCommerce platforms, accounting software, and marketing tools. This creates a unified ecosystem for smoother data flow and automation.

Hardware Compatibility

Your POS should work with your existing hardware setup, including barcode scanners, printers, and tablets. Compatibility reduces initial costs and setup time.

Ease of Use

An intuitive interface means faster employee onboarding and fewer operational mistakes. Look for systems with a user-friendly dashboard and customizable workflows tailored for music stores.
